I know we joked about the 747 passing above the Cessna, but a lot of you weren't around in September of 1978, when a commercial airliner and a Cessna 172 were in the same type of scenario, and the outcome was very tragic. Pacific Southwest Airlines (PSA) flight 182, a Boeing 727, and the Cessna 172 with an instructor and a student pilot, were involved in a mid-air collision, both aircraft crashed into neighborhoods in San Diego, CA and 144 people lost their lives, including 9 on the ground. :-( en.wikipedia.org/wiki/PSA_Flight_182

Looks like you were originally tuning-in to the ILS frequency for RW-25 Right on NavCom 1 with 111.10 at the 20:50 mark, but then your radio configuration ended-up tuned-in to RW-25 Left on 119.90 which is probably more consistent with standard landing procedure at LAX. I think they generally take off from the 2 interior runways 25R and 24L and land on the exterior runways to help with separation. There apparently was a major fatal accident that happened on 24L in 1991 when a 737 was cleared to land and it hit a twin turbo prop waiting for takeoff on the same runway further down the runway. The FAA recommended separating traffic that way but they apparently did not put it into practice until 2004 when another accident almost happened with a 747 landing on the same runway 24L and 737 was lined up and waiting for takeoff 200 feet beneath the path of the 747 landing right above it.
